I hope they make Club Sport Light mean something. The E46 M3 CSL was 243 lbs lighter than the regular M3. I expect that to be a minimum target for the G82 CSL.

Absolutely not, I think this varies by state but it is not legal to sell a car with a half cage which is why companies like Porsche that offer $0 options in other countries to buy cars with factory installed half cages have never been able to offer the option to the US. I can't think of any single car sold in the US with a factory installed harness bar / half cage.
